The Grand Ducal Fire and Rescue Corps (CGDIS) reported a series of accidents that took place across Luxembourg on Thursday afternoon and evening, resulting in seven injuries.

The first incident involved a collision between two vehicles shortly after midday in Kockelscheuer. Two people were injured and treated by the Emergency Medical Assistance Service (SAMU).

At around 1.30pm, a lorry crashed into a wall in Bissen.

Later that afternoon, at 3.30pm, a motorcyclist sustained injuries in a crash that occurred in Banzelt.

Another accident involving a car and a motorcycle happened in Merl shortly before 4pm, with one person reported injured.

Another motorcyclist was injured in a crash in Esch-sur-Alzette, specifically in the S. Allende neighbourhood, at around 8.45pm.

The day’s incidents concluded with two separate single-vehicle crashes shortly after 10pm. These accidents occurred on Route de Luxembourg in Pontpierre and Rue de Bridel in Steinsel, respectively, leaving a total of two people injured.
